#52b51e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#52b51e is composed of 32.2% red, 71% green and 11.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 54.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 83.4% yellow and 29% black. It has a hue angle of 99.3 degrees, a saturation of 71.6% and a lightness of 41.4%. #52b51e color hex could be obtained by blending #a4ff3c with #006b00. Closest websafe color is: #66cc33.

Shades and Tints of #52b51e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060d02 is the darkest color, while #fcfefb is the lightest one.

Tones of #52b51e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#696c67 is the less saturated color, while #4acd06 is the most saturated one.
